Pragmatically you can size for realistic or anticipated usage. So you’ll have to convert each btu input rating to cubic feet of gas before sizing the distribution piping. You can assume that each cubic foot of natural gas releases 1,000 btu per hour. The sizing charts above list the specific pipe sizes required for the amount of btu’s for a new gas line installations.
